// Copyright (c) 2010 The Chromium OS Authors. All rights reserved.
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
// found in the LICENSE file.
#include <string>
#include <vector>
#include <gtest/gtest.h>
#include "base/logging.h"
#include "update_engine/payload_signer.h"
#include "update_engine/update_metadata.pb.h"
#include "update_engine/utils.h"
using std::string;
using std::vector;
// Note: the test key was generated with the following command:
// openssl genrsa -out unittest_key.pem 1024
namespace chromeos_update_engine {
const char* kUnittestPrivateKeyPath = "unittest_key.pem";
//class PayloadSignerTest : public ::testing::Test {};
TEST(PayloadSignerTest, SimpleTest) {
// Some data and its corresponding signature:
const string kDataToSign = "This is some data to sign.";
const char kExpectedSignature[] = {

};
string data_path;
ASSERT_TRUE(
utils::MakeTempFile("/tmp/data.XXXXXX", &data_path, NULL));
ScopedPathUnlinker data_path_unlinker(data_path);
ASSERT_TRUE(utils::WriteFile(data_path.c_str(),
kDataToSign.data(),
kDataToSign.size()));
uint64_t length = 0;
EXPECT_TRUE(PayloadSigner::SignatureBlobLength(kUnittestPrivateKeyPath,
&length));
EXPECT_GT(length, 0);
vector<char> signature_blob;
EXPECT_TRUE(PayloadSigner::SignPayload(data_path,
kUnittestPrivateKeyPath,
&signature_blob));
EXPECT_EQ(length, signature_blob.size());
// Check the signature itself
Signatures signatures;
EXPECT_TRUE(signatures.ParseFromArray(&signature_blob[0],
signature_blob.size()));
EXPECT_EQ(1, signatures.signatures_size());
const Signatures_Signature& signature = signatures.signatures(0);
EXPECT_EQ(kSignatureMessageVersion, signature.version());
const string sig_data = signature.data();
ASSERT_EQ(sizeof(kExpectedSignature), sig_data.size());
for (size_t i = 0; i < sizeof(kExpectedSignature); i++) {
EXPECT_EQ(kExpectedSignature[i], sig_data[i]);
}
}
} // namespace chromeos_update_engine
